Most of the models of embedded DOS industrial control motherboards provided by Intron provide Ethernet interfaces. These Ethernet network interfaces conform to the physical and electrical characteristics of the standard Ethernet network interface. Customers only need to use standard RJ45 connectors to lead it out and connect it to the Ethernet network that the customer wants to communicate with.

In the tide of informatization development, in applications such as industrial automation, power equipment, communication management, smart terminals, smart cells, etc., due to its advantages of fast speed, good versatility, strong scalability, etc., Ethernet networks are becoming equipment. The main way of communication between. Intron DOS embedded network module not only provides the physical interface of the Ethernet network, but also provides supporting commercial-grade TCP / IP software protocol library and related routines. It is a cheap and good choice for users to develop embedded Ethernet network terminal equipment. .


Use Intron Embedded Network Module for TCP / IP Ethernet communication

The TCP / IP protocol library provided by Intron for free is based on excellent commercial software source code, and after long-term comprehensive testing, its performance is stable and reliable, and it has high transmission indicators. The protocol library is generated by Borland C / C ++ programming, which can be easily linked into user applications, helping to quickly complete the development of various network application products.

Intron's TCP / IP protocol library is aimed at the characteristics of embedded application development. It takes "connection" as the object and encapsulates a few application API functions, covering most applications of embedded network development. It has good usability and flexibility. Sex. The basic running space is less than 90K.

According to the frame structure of Ethernet, the maximum length of the data segment is 1500 bytes.

According to the TCP / IP standard, the minimum length of the IP datagram header is 20 bytes, the minimum length of the TCP segment header is 20 bytes, and the minimum length of the UDP user datagram header is 8 bytes. It can be seen that the maximum packet length of TCP is 1500-20-20 = 1460Bytes, and the maximum packet length of UDP is 1500-20-8 = 1472Bytes.

Wifi Antenna Description

Wi-Fi wireless networking works by sending radio transmissions on specific frequencies where listening devices can receive them. The necessary radio transmitters and receivers are built into Wi-Fi enabled equipment like routers, laptops, and phones. Antennas are key components of these radio communication systems, picking up incoming signals or radiating outgoing Wi-Fi signals. Some Wi-Fi antennas, particularly on routers, may be mounted externally, while others are embedded inside the device's hardware enclosure.

WIFI Antenna (2.4G Antenna) is one kind of wireless antennas.The main operating frequency of WLAN is 2.4Ghz and 5.8Ghz.

WiFi antenna(WLAN antenna)is installed on wireless devices like WLAN AP to reinforce signal strength.Wireless device will radiate signal in air at specified frequency 2.4Ghz or 5.8Ghz through WiFi antenna/WLAN antennas and allow other WLAN devices like NB or smartphone to get signal at same frequency range.

WLAN or WiFi is based on IEEE 802.11a,802.11b,802.11g,802.11n standards.WLAN or WiFi provides a connection through a WLAN AP,and this technology allows people can be connected to the networks within a coverage area.
